@haskellru

Страница 311 из 1551
Dmitry
22.06.2017
08:16:58
ладно, звиняюсь за офтоп

но вот такой вопрос, касаемый выбора KV-базы

embdedded vs server

embedded - теоретически быстро работает, т.к. в адресном пространстве процесса. но нельзя ли пренебречь этим фактором - т.к. мы через один локальный сетевой интерфейс легко заливаем 20 - 30 гигабит в секунду и всё естественно упирается в диск?

Google
Max
22.06.2017
08:18:27
Ее надо как-то особо одминить в отрыве от приложения?

Dmitry
22.06.2017
08:18:38
зато standalone сервер позволяет конкурентный доступ из разных приложений

и не надо самому париться

Max
22.06.2017
08:18:49
Если нет - встраивай

Dmitry
22.06.2017
08:19:02
надо что бы одно приложение туда писало, а другое читало

и получается, что надо или делать сервер

Max
22.06.2017
08:19:13
Тогда сервер

Dmitry
22.06.2017
08:19:25
который будет интерфейсы предоставлять для этого

Max
22.06.2017
08:19:34
Потому как где два, там и три

Dmitry
22.06.2017
08:19:38
или писать отдельно, потом переключать на реплику

короче какой-то гемор на ровном месте

Max
22.06.2017
08:19:52
REST API )))

Dmitry
22.06.2017
08:20:04
да это проблема, так как надо заливать ну мегадохрена данных

Google
Dmitry
22.06.2017
08:20:18
через REST API это уныловато

Max
22.06.2017
08:20:25
Ну или сделай встроенную с интерфейсом интеграций

Но кусками обновлять не получится

Dmitry
22.06.2017
08:20:55
да не, вопрос в том, что может не выделываться и взять какую-то быструю kv-базу с сервером?

Max
22.06.2017
08:21:11
Редис

Dmitry
22.06.2017
08:21:19
редис - ок?

Max
22.06.2017
08:21:33
Пока не подводил

Ну, или тарантул)))))

Ну, чтобы повозиться)

Dmitry
22.06.2017
08:23:32
мне щас вообще не до приключений

мне нужно что-то такое нобрейнер

Max
22.06.2017
08:23:52
Редис.

Dmitry
22.06.2017
08:23:55
куда можно быстро залить дофига данных и конкурентно к ним доступать

данные - kv

Max
22.06.2017
08:24:02
Работы дофига?

Dmitry
22.06.2017
08:24:10
работы ты что именно имеешь ввиду7

которую надо над данными совершать?

над данными kv залили, kv запросили

единственная проблема, что нужны не только инсерты, но и апдейты

Max
22.06.2017
08:24:57
Агрегация?

Google
Max
22.06.2017
08:25:14
Фильтры?

Диапазоны?

Dmitry
22.06.2017
08:25:24
не особо

нужен большой хэшмэп

Max
22.06.2017
08:25:52
Точно? А то мож сразу постгрес?

Dmitry
22.06.2017
08:25:53
единственная проблема что при записи надо агрегировать значения в ячейке хэша

постгрес тормоз при записи

да и вообще тормоз

Max
22.06.2017
08:26:30
Ну, отложенная там вроде есть.

Но так да.

Dmitry
22.06.2017
08:26:46
ну и биндинг к нему тормозной

в нужный нам язык. как выяснилось

а что не так с редисом-то?

в смысле, он случаем не для in-memory данных ?

с другой стороны, у нас база ну 40 - 80 гигабайт,

по любому в память вроде влезает.

Vladimir
22.06.2017
08:39:43
и это в хачкеле-то с зелёными тредами?

oh u

Dmitry
22.06.2017
08:41:43
при большой нагрузке у тебя всё зеленое становится красным

Google
Vladimir
22.06.2017
08:42:27
при любой нагрузке диск/сеть медленнее проца

в любом случае здесь равнение на количество ядер непонятно, хачкель же сам это расшедулить должен

Евгений
22.06.2017
08:47:00
Одно ядро не может уткнуться в шину никак

Anatolii
22.06.2017
08:48:40
в смысле, он случаем не для in-memory данных ?
редис хранит все в памяти и делает дамп на жесткий иногда

Dmitry
22.06.2017
08:48:52
да, уже понял, что не катит

Anatolii
22.06.2017
09:16:07
товарищи, а тут есть люди живые кто Riak юзает?

Alexey
22.06.2017
09:16:24
сам то риак еще жив?

Max
22.06.2017
09:16:42
Не юзал, но осуждаю

Anatolii
22.06.2017
09:16:49
ну развиваться он не будет уже

но так вроде жив здоров

ну хотелось бы и узнать

жив ли он и здоров

может кто смелый есть кто юзает такое

Dmitry
22.06.2017
09:17:49
а что-то вообще на рынке носикля да и баз вообще как-то пустынно

Max
22.06.2017
09:18:22
Ну, это нынче не хайп

Денег не дают

Поэтому можно забить

Остались только самые стойкие.

Dmitry
22.06.2017
09:19:26
но проблема как зафигачить много данных очень быстро в базу ведь никуда не делась

а потом еще надежно хранить возможно с репликацией и шардингом

Google
Vladimir
22.06.2017
09:20:36
ну развиваться он не будет уже
а что там за история?

лопнул стартап?

Anatolii
22.06.2017
09:21:48
я в двух местах читал/слышал что основные разработчики ушли из команды

Basho продает еще что-то

пока живы

Anatolii
22.06.2017
09:22:37
вот этого я не знаю

просто в один момент основные чуваки резко свалили

Richter
22.06.2017
09:47:04
всем привет

не ожидал столько людей увидеть здесь

Alexander
22.06.2017
09:55:36
опа.. async $ waitProcessHandle не cancell-ится..

RTS -threaded конечно же

Dmitry
22.06.2017
10:00:06
вы слишком долго писали на хаскелле, если при попытке собрать сишный проект делаете stack build

Евгений
22.06.2017
11:48:08
а что-то вообще на рынке носикля да и баз вообще как-то пустынно
Ну типа есть редис и мемкеш, всё остальное сдохло, так как не выдержало конкуренции. Ща идёт борьба за звание NewSQL

Dmitry
22.06.2017
11:54:43
редис он же ин-мемори с eventually персистенсом

Alexander
22.06.2017
11:55:44
eventual persistence это как eventual consistency?

возможно с какой-то веротяностью данные и будут консистентными, но на практике в 90% случаев это будет не так?

Anatolii
22.06.2017
11:56:30
ну редис можно настроить на каждую запись в дисмк писать

но мне страшно представить насколько медленно это будет

Страница 311 из 1551